About
Seth Meyers is an American comedian, television host, writer, actor, and producer. He is the host of *Late Night with Seth Meyers* on NBC, a late-night talk show he has hosted since 2014. Before his hosting role, Meyers was a cast member on *Saturday Night Live* (SNL) for thirteen seasons, where he also served as head writer and anchor of the *Weekend Update* segment. He is known for his sharp wit, political humor, and engaging interviews.
